CIMC Raffles and Golar LNG Sign Landmark FLNG EPC Contract xinde marine news Pang Kai 2024-09-19 17:44


On September 17, CIMC Raffles, a subsidiary of CIMC Group, signed a 1+1 EPC contract with Golar LNG, a global leader in FLNG operations, for the construction of a Floating Liquefied Natural Gas (FLNG) production, storage, and offloading unit. This marks a significant milestone for CIMC, as it embarks on its first FLNG project, underscoring its commitment to advancing green development and supporting China’s “3060” dual carbon goals.


About FLNG:
FLNG units are floating platforms designed to liquefy, store, and offload natural gas directly from offshore fields, allowing for the extraction of gas in remote areas without the need for onshore infrastructure. FLNG is regarded as one of the most complex and high-value products in the marine engineering industry, often referred to as the “new crown jewel” of offshore engineering.

Project Details:
Length: Approximately 390 meters
Width: 70 meters
Annual production: 3.5 million tons of liquefied natural gas
Delivery: Scheduled for 2027
Once delivered, this FLNG will enhance Golar LNG’s fleet and strengthen its competitive position in the global energy market. With energy security becoming a critical concern for many countries, the demand for FLNG technology is expected to grow, positioning FLNG as a key player in offshore gas development.
Golar LNG projects that the number of FLNG units could nearly double in the next five years, with global FLNG capacity reaching over 60 million tons annually by 2030.
